On Thu, 06 Apr, at 04:55:11PM, Mark Rutland wrote:
> 
> Please, let's keep the Xen knowledge constrained to the Xen EFI wrapper,
> rather than spreading it further.
> 
> IMO, given reset_system is a *mandatory* function, the Xen wrapper
> should provide an implementation.
> 
> I don't see why you can't implement a wrapper that calls the usual Xen
> poweroff/reset functions.

I realise I'm making a sweeping generalisation, but adding
EFI_PARAVIRT is almost always the wrong thing to do.

I'd much prefer to see Mark's idea implemented.
